Output 03d8ebe407d998df7621f16efe612243f4a3af85fd4d9fa27aa43df5e8933b1d:19

value
3331924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ec727f44680825b61d17aff1036a9cc506b0d851 OP_EQUAL
address
3PFEZDVwkPCYtwfkaB98t93ZU9EzNMxFtU
transaction
03d8ebe407d998df7621f16efe612243f4a3af85fd4d9fa27aa43df5e8933b1d